    How to start and stop service on Lubuntu

    How to start and stop service on Lubuntu

    A single computer may have a lot of service running in the background, for example on my lubuntu i have apache web server, mysql database server, and php fpm running in the background, these are services. So how do i start and stop these services?

    Lucky for us lubuntu users, lubuntu/ubuntu have special command line tool for starting, stopping, and restarting a service, it's also possible to get the status of the service. The tool for managing services is called service and this tool need to run under root permission.

    1. Showing status of all services 
    service --status-all
    



    2. How to stop a running service
    sudo service [service-name] stop
    
    Example
    sudo service mysql stop
    
    sudo service apache stop
    



    3. How to start a service
    sudo service [service-name] start
    
    Example
    sudo service apache start
    
    sudo service nginx start
    



    4. How to restart a service
    sudo service [service-name] restart
    
    or
    sudo service [service-name] reload
    
    Example
    sudo service nginx reload
    
    sudo service nginx restart
    
    sudo service mysql restart
    



    5. How to show status of a service
    sudo service [service-name] status
    
    Example
    sudo service apache status
    
    sudo service mysql status
    


    The service command also have other parameters that might be useful for you:
    • force-reload
    • configtest
    • rotate
    • upgrade
